Transaction 73a8998358ec07f921563de16838b9aab3aff81060c38ba0fc533e5e2936279a
1 Input
1 Output
-
73a8998358ec07f921563de16838b9aab3aff81060c38ba0fc533e5e2936279a:0
- value
- 236742200
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0be10d3e938561ee54ae04b81a2941c6110f26ac OP_EQUAL
- address
- 32mpxXGRssPMBC6Yt75phAJYTqvyi1eQxU